Output ccf67cae630ef1c623179a343a91f1c0e6a906af7c548d60ae47bb24b8955ff3:28

value
29234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0982ab889155bbf528bb25b9ae6b6a8721c7c02b OP_EQUAL
address
32ZJYPGDZHaofGFSY69uwTy5K3uiXRQWCc
transaction
ccf67cae630ef1c623179a343a91f1c0e6a906af7c548d60ae47bb24b8955ff3
confirmations
185509
spent
true